All'Antico Vinaio ★ 4.4

Street foodcentro-storicoMon-Sun 10:00-22:00

All'Antico Vinaio in Florence's Via dei Neri has run the schiacciata-counter format since 1991, with the Mazzanti family stuffing the 30cm flatbread to order.

Try: Schiacciata sandwich

Order: La Favolosa schiacciata (porchetta, pecorino, artichoke cream) for €8.

Tip: Four shops on Via dei Neri now (1r, 38r, 65r, 76r). The Via dei Neri 65r counter is the original.

I Due Fratellini ★ 4.5

Street foodcentro-storicoMon-Sat 10:00-19:30Cash only

I Due Fratellini in Florence's Via dei Cimatori has run the mini-panino counter since 1875, a hole-in-the-wall format with 28 panini varieties for €4.

Try: Mini panini

Order: Wild boar salami panino, the soppressata-and-pecorino, a glass of house Chianti.

Tip: Cash only; standing room on the kerb. Closed Sunday. The shelves outside hold your wine glass.

Da Nerbone ★ 4.6

Street foodsan-lorenzoMon-Sat 08:00-15:00Cash only

Da Nerbone in Florence's Mercato Centrale ground floor has poured the lampredotto panino since 1872, the bread dipped in the cooking broth and stuffed.

Try: Lampredotto panino

Order: Panino al lampredotto bagnato (dipped) with salsa verde and salsa piccante.

Tip: Cash only; closed Sunday. Queue from 11:30 for lunch; standing-only counter inside the market.

Trippaio del Porcellino ★ 4.4

Street foodcentro-storicoMon-Sun 09:00-20:00Cash only

Trippaio del Porcellino in Florence is the lampredotto cart at the Mercato Nuovo loggia, next to the Porcellino bronze boar, with the lampredotto and trippa.

Try: Lampredotto cart

Order: Panino al lampredotto with salsa verde, trippa-and-fagioli plate for €7.

Tip: Cash only; the cart moves around the loggia. Standing only; lunch is the busiest hour.

Trattoria da Rocco ★ 4.1

Street foodsant-ambrogioMon-Sat 12:00-15:00Cash only

Trattoria da Rocco in Florence's Mercato Sant'Ambrogio loggia runs the market-canteen format under the iron roof, with a chalkboard daily carte at €12.

Try: Market-canteen pasta

Order: The daily pasta, ribollita in winter, a quartino of house red.

Tip: Lunch only, Mon-Sat 12:00-15:00. Cash only. Come at 12:30 to beat the stall-keepers.

Mercato Centrale (first floor) ★ 4.3

Street foodsan-lorenzoMon-Sun 09:00-24:00

Mercato Centrale Florence's first-floor food hall houses 18 artisan-producer counters under one roof, from lampredotto and bistecca to fresh pasta and pizza.

Try: Food-hall multiple counters

Order: Lampredotto from Lorenzo Nigro's counter, fresh pasta from il Tartufo, an espresso from Ditta Artigianale.

Tip: Open daily until midnight; ground-floor market closes 14:00. The food hall is the late-night option.
